AOM-0605 — Enhanced Terminal Operations with RNP transition to ILS/GLS/LPV

RNP transition to ILS/GLS/LPV with curved procedures connecting directly to the final approach can provide improved access in obstacle rich environments and can reduce environmental impact. RNP transition to ILS/GLS/LPV should be compatible with CDA operations, where appropriate.

Rationale
RNP transitions to ILS/GLS/LPV will enable reduced track miles in the terminal area and relax airport constraints due to noise restrictions.
